Build Production-Ready Data Pipelines
Master enterprise data engineering with hands-on courses in ETL processing, stream analytics, and cloud architecture. Transform raw data into business intelligence.
Professional Data Engineering Courses
Comprehensive programs designed for building production-grade data systems with real-world applications and industry-standard tools.
Data Pipeline Fundamentals & ETL Processing
Master foundational data engineering concepts with hands-on ETL pipeline development using Python, SQL, and Apache Spark. Build scalable data architectures for enterprise processing.
- Apache Spark & Airflow orchestration
- Cloud warehouse integration
- Data quality frameworks
- Production monitoring & logging
Stream Processing & Real-Time Analytics
Build high-velocity streaming data systems with Apache Kafka, Flink, and Spark Streaming. Handle millions of events with sub-second latency requirements.
- Event-driven architectures
- Complex event processing
- State management & backpressure
- Lambda architecture patterns
Cloud Data Platform Architecture & DevOps
Design enterprise data platforms across AWS, Azure, and GCP. Master DataOps practices with infrastructure as code and automated deployment strategies.
- Multi-cloud data strategies
- Terraform & Kubernetes
- DataOps CI/CD pipelines
- Petabyte-scale architecture
Production-Ready Engineering Excellence
Our curriculum focuses on real-world data engineering challenges with hands-on experience using enterprise-grade tools and methodologies.
Scalable Architecture Design
Learn to design data systems that handle petabyte-scale workloads with cost optimization and performance tuning.
Enterprise Security & Compliance
Implement data governance frameworks with encryption, access controls, and regulatory compliance standards.
Performance Optimization
Master query optimization, indexing strategies, and resource management for high-throughput data processing.
System Architecture Overview
Ready to Build Your Data Engineering Career?
Join hundreds of professionals who have advanced their careers with our comprehensive data engineering programs. Start your transformation today.
Frequently Asked Questions
Everything you need to know about our data engineering programs
What technical background is required for these courses?
Students should have basic programming experience in Python or Java, familiarity with SQL databases, and understanding of fundamental computer science concepts. Prior experience with cloud platforms is helpful but not required.
How long does each course take to complete?
Course duration varies: Fundamentals takes 8-10 weeks, Stream Processing requires 12-14 weeks, and Cloud Architecture spans 16-20 weeks. All programs include hands-on labs and project work with flexible scheduling options.
What tools and platforms will I learn?
You'll work with Apache Spark, Kafka, Airflow, Flink, Docker, Kubernetes, Terraform, and major cloud platforms (AWS, Azure, GCP). All software access is provided during the course period.
Are there any financing options available?
Yes, we offer flexible payment plans and corporate sponsorship options. Individual courses can be paid in installments, and we provide early registration discounts for multiple course enrollments.
What ongoing support is provided after course completion?
Graduates receive 6 months of technical support, access to updated course materials, professional networking opportunities, and career placement assistance through our industry partner network.
Visit Our Cyprus Campus
Located in the heart of Nicosia's technology district
Address
89 Athalassa Avenue
2024 Nicosia, Cyprus
Phone
+357 22 674539
info@domain.com
Start Your Data Engineering Journey
Get personalized course recommendations and enrollment information